Introduction

Fixing Nerf bullets is a common concern among Nerf enthusiasts, as these foam darts can often become damaged or worn from regular use. Understanding how to effectively repair Nerf bullets can enhance your gameplay experience, ensuring that your blaster functions smoothly and accurately.

Here are some reasons why fixing Nerf bullets is beneficial:
  • Cost-Effective: Repairing your Nerf bullets can save you money compared to constantly buying new ones.
  • Eco-Friendly: By fixing and reusing your Nerf darts, you contribute to reducing waste.
  • Improved Performance: Well-maintained darts fly straighter and have better range, enhancing your competitive edge.

Common issues that may require fixing include bent tips, foam tears, or loss of elasticity. Simple fixes can often be done at home using household materials, such as glue or tape. Additionally, some Nerf enthusiasts even modify their darts for improved performance, which can involve techniques like adding weight or altering the foam.

Remember, the key to effective fixing is to assess the damage and determine the best repair method. With a little creativity and resourcefulness, you can keep your Nerf bullets in top condition, ready for your next battle. Whether you're a casual player or a serious competitor, knowing how to fix Nerf bullets can enhance your enjoyment and ensure you are always ready for action.

FAQs

How can I choose the best method for fixing my Nerf bullets?

Assess the damage to your Nerf bullets first. For minor tears, glue may suffice, while bent tips may require replacement. Research various fixing techniques online to find one that suits your needs.

What are the key features to look for when selecting materials for fixing Nerf bullets?

Look for strong adhesives, flexible materials for repairs, and tools that allow precise application. Ensure that the materials you choose won't damage the foam or affect its performance.

Are there any common mistakes people make when fixing Nerf bullets?

Yes, common mistakes include using too much glue, which can weigh down the bullet, or using inappropriate materials that can damage the foam. Always test your repairs before using them in a game.

Can I modify Nerf bullets for better performance?

Yes, many enthusiasts modify their Nerf bullets by adding weight or changing the foam type. However, be cautious as modifications can affect safety and performance.

How often should I check my Nerf bullets for damage?

It's a good practice to check your Nerf bullets after each play session. Regular inspections can help you catch and fix issues early, ensuring optimal performance.
